Output 66b95adbe7922524a5466aef4e99e18363c6e3ae86ddf389c549543600eee993:1

value
7368
script pubkey
OP_0 OP_PUSHBYTES_20 d8a8734234635eede3a4fe5034cd331c38df5935
address
bc1qmz58xs35vd0wmcaylegrfnfnrsud7kf4xpch2k
transaction
66b95adbe7922524a5466aef4e99e18363c6e3ae86ddf389c549543600eee993